Algae. LC Science Tracer Bullet.
Niskern, Diana, Comp.
The plants and plantlike organisms informally grouped together as algae show great diversity of form and size and occur in a wide variety of habitats. These extremely important photosynthesizers are also economically significant. For example, some species contaminate water supplies; others provide food for aquatic animals and for man; still others yield agar, diatomaceous earth, or fertilizer. This guide to the literature on algae is not intended to be a comprehensive bibliography, but is designed to provide the reader with a set of resources that can be used to focus on the topics. The document lists the subject headings used by the Library of Congress in cataloging information on algae. It also contains citations of materials categorized as: (1) introductions to the topic; (2) general surveys; (3) additional titles; (4) handbooks; (5) bibliographies; (6) reviews and conference proceedings; (7) government publications; (8) abstracting and indexing services; (9) journals; (10) representative journal articles; (11) technical reports; and (12) selected materials.
